The Wyndham Active Revitalisation Program is intended to support the sustainability of Wyndham sporting clubs and organisations, through minor capital upgrades which enable them to better engage Wyndham residents to be healthy and active.
Project ideas will originate from community organisations, in a similar model to a grant program, however Council will manage the procurement, quoting and delivery of the project.
Project Funding Streams:
Each club/community organisation can apply for 1x small and 1x medium project for consideration.
Small projects – up to the value of $50,000 (GST Exclusive)
Medium projects – up to the value of $200,000 (GST Exclusive)
Eligibility
Community organisations must be not-for-profit and currently hold, or have held in the last 12 months, a tenancy agreement (lease, licence or hire agreement) at a Wyndham City Council sporting facility (outdoor or indoor).
What projects will be funded:
In line with eligibility criteria, applications may include:
- Minor lighting installations or LED conversions
- Training facilities (cricket nets, batting cages etc)
- Turf cricket wickets (subject to turf wicket allocation process)
- Open Space improvements, including behind goal netting, scoreboards, booking/access systems, portable goals, seating, storage, CCTV or other projects assessed on a case-by-case basis.
- Minor kitchen refurbishments (Capital works)
- Major sports equipment (Capital works)
Please note - Any projects which note an asset within Council's public open space, must be in line with Council's Open Space specifications and guidelines.
Council may consider funding requests outside of Council's Sports Facility Capital Development Guide, which can be found here - Sports Facility Capital Development Guide 2020-2025 | Wyndham City. These requests will only be considered, where the organisation agrees to enter into a formal agreement with Council which places them responsible for the future maintenance and renewal requirements of the asset beyond the initial capital investment, e.g. Electronic Scoreboards.
What projects will not be funded?
- Operational expenses, including uniforms and minor sports equipment
- Projects above the value of $200,000 in the medium stream that have no other form of contributions to cover the funding difference/shortfall
- Projects above the value of $50k in the small stream that have no other form of contributions to cover the difference/shortfall
Please note - No more than 25% of the funding pool will be allocated in any one suburb within the municipality.
